
Marziyeh Jafari
Marziyeh Jafari is the head coach of the Iranian women's national football team, recognized for her strategic acumen and leadership that led her team to secure a spot in the 2026 AFC Women’s Asian Cup. Under her guidance, the team achieved a remarkable victory against Jordan, showcasing their resilience and determination in the qualifying round.
